Education Encyclopedia

The “Education Encyclopedia” is a comprehensive resource that provides detailed information on various educational topics, concepts, and theories. It serves as an encyclopedia specifically focused on the field of education, offering a wealth of knowledge. Insights for educators, students, researchers, and anyone interested in understanding the intricacies of education.

The encyclopedia covers a wide range of subjects within the education domain, including:

  • Educational theories and philosophies: It delves into different educational theories and philosophies that have shaped the field. Such as constructivism, behaviorism, and progressivism.
  • Teaching methodologies and strategies: It provides information on various strategies. Including cooperative learning, differentiated instruction, and project-based learning.
  • Curriculum development and assessment: It discusses curriculum development processes and assessment techniques used in education, addressing topics. Such as curriculum design, standards, and testing.
  • Educational psychology and learning theories: It explores educational psychology and learning theories. Including theories of cognitive development, motivation, and the psychology of learning.

  • Educational technology and innovation: It covers the integration of technology in education. The use of educational software, online learning, and innovative teaching tools.
  • Educational leadership and management: It addresses educational leadership and management practices, including school administration, policy-making, and resource allocation.
  • Special education and inclusion: It provides information on special education and inclusion practices, catering to the needs of students with disabilities and ensuring their successful participation in education.
  • Comparative education and international perspectives: It explores comparative education and international perspectives, examining different educational systems around the world and drawing comparisons to identify best practices.

At Last Words

The “Education Encyclopedia” aims to provide accurate, up-to-date, and comprehensive information on these topics and more. Making it a valuable resource for anyone seeking to deepen their understanding of education and its various facets.
